Designing for Minimal Power Consumption

The convergence of deep learning algorithms and resource-constrained devices has ushered in a new era of smart product design. Ultra-low power system design is no longer just an goal, but a necessity for unlocking the full potential of edge AI. By meticulously optimizing hardware and software, we can empower devices to perform complex functions while consuming minimal energy. This breakthrough has profound implications across diverse industries, enabling transformative applications in areas such as healthcare, intelligent transportation, and industrial automation.

  • Exploiting specialized hardware architectures, such as custom-designed processors and memory subsystems, can significantly reduce power consumption.
  • Utilizing efficient algorithms and data structures tailored for resource-constrained environments is crucial.
  • Optimizing software execution to minimize wake-up intervals and execution time can lead to substantial power savings.

The Rise of Edge AI: A Paradigm Shift in Computing

The realm of computing is undergoing a significant transformation with the emergence of edge AI. This innovative approach shifts processing power from centralized cloud servers to embedded devices at the application's edge. This paradigm shift empowers devices to analyze data in real-time, enabling quicker responses and optimized user experiences. Edge AI's ability to operate autonomously also minimizes latency and bandwidth demands, making it ideal for applications requiring immediate decision-making.

  • Moreover, edge AI's ability to process sensitive data locally enhances privacy and security.

Distributed AI: Exploring the Benefits and Applications

Edge AI refers to a paradigm shift in artificial intelligence where computational processes are carried out locally on devices themselves, rather than relying solely on centralized cloud servers. This decentralized approach offers a plethora of compelling benefits, including reduced latency, improved data privacy, and enhanced system responsiveness. By bringing AI capabilities closer to the data source, Edge AI empowers devices to make real-time decisions without the need for constant internet connectivity. Applications for Edge AI are vast and ever-expanding. In the realm of autonomous residences, Edge AI enables intelligent appliances, personalized environments, and enhanced security read more measures. Within the transportation sector, it powers autonomous driving features, predictive maintenance, and real-time traffic optimization.

  • Moreover, Edge AI finds applications in industrial automation, enabling efficient process monitoring, predictive analytics, and quality control.
